How to Check Your JNTUH Results 2026 on jntuhresults.in – A Step-by-Step Guide
Accessing your JNTUH UG/PG results 2026 is a straightforward process, provided you follow the official guidelines. To ensure you retrieve your accurate scorecard, head straight to the designated JNTUH results portal. Here’s a detailed guide:
- Visit the Official Portal: Open your web browser and navigate to the official JNTUH results website: jntuhresults.in. Beware of unofficial sites that may provide incorrect or delayed information.
- Locate the Results Link: On the homepage, look for the specific link pertaining to your course and semester (e.g., 'B.Tech R18 3-2 Results', 'M.Tech 1-2 Results', etc.). The links are usually clearly labelled for UG and PG programmes.
- Enter Your Credentials: Click on the relevant link. You will be redirected to a login page where you need to enter your JNTUH Hall Ticket Number and other required details (such as your date of birth or captcha code) as prompted. Double-check for accuracy to avoid errors.
- View Your Result: After entering the details, click on the 'Submit' or 'Get Result' button. Your detailed JNTUH scorecard will be displayed on the screen.
- Download and Print: It is highly recommended to download a copy of your provisional marksheet for your records. You can also print it out for future reference or counselling processes.
Always remember that the results published online are provisional. The official hard copy of your marksheet will be issued by the university later, which you can collect from your respective college.

Understanding Your JNTUH Scorecard and Key Dates for Re-evaluation
Your JNTUH scorecard is more than just a list of marks; it's a comprehensive overview of your performance across various subjects. Typically, it includes your subject-wise marks, total marks, credits, and overall SGPA/CGPA. Carefully review each section to ensure there are no discrepancies.
Important Dates and Procedures for Re-evaluation/Recounting:
If you believe there has been an error in the evaluation of your answer script, JNTUH provides an opportunity for re-evaluation or recounting. It's crucial to be aware of the official deadlines:
| Process | Details | Key Points |
| Application Window | JNTUH typically opens a re-evaluation/recounting application window for 1–2 weeks after result declaration. | Students should regularly check official notifications for deadlines. |
| Application Process | Applications are submitted online through the university portal or designated result website. | A prescribed fee is charged for each subject applied for. |
| Recounting | The university re-tallies marks and verifies that all answers have been evaluated. | No fresh assessment of answers is conducted. |
| Re-evaluation | The answer script is reassessed by another examiner. | Provides a complete review of the evaluation process. |
| Supplementary Exams | Conducted for students who have not cleared one or more subjects. | Offers an opportunity to improve scores and complete academic requirements. |
Always refer to the official JNTUH notifications for the most accurate and up-to-date information regarding fees, deadlines, and application procedures. Making timely decisions can significantly impact your academic progression.

Q: How can I check my JNTUH Results 2026?
You can check your JNTUH results for UG and PG semester programs directly on the official university portal, jntuhresults.in. Navigate to the relevant results link for your course and semester, enter your Hall Ticket Number, and submit to view your detailed scorecard.
Q: What should I do if I am not satisfied with my JNTUH results?
If you are not satisfied with your JNTUH results, you have options for re-evaluation or recounting of your answer scripts. JNTUH announces specific application windows and procedures for these. Additionally, you can opt for supplementary examinations to improve your grades in failed subjects. Consult official JNTUH notifications for deadlines and application details.
Q: Is jntuhresults.in the only official portal for checking JNTUH results?
Yes, jntuhresults.in is the primary and official portal designated by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University Hyderabad for publishing semester examination results for its UG and PG programs. It is always recommended to use this official website to ensure the accuracy and authenticity of your results.
